Kast van een Huis

Kasthuizen

More great stuff for kids this morning! “Kast van een Huis” are very special closets for kids. The idea was born when Marie-Louise Reesink was looking for closets for her own children. She couldn't find any that looked nice and was multifunctional at the same time. So she decided to design her own series of closets. And with great scucess!

Kasthuis

Her closets are designed as storage for clothes, toys, books, but you can also store grown-up stuff such as office equipment. The best thing is that the models are inspired by the Amsterdam canalhouses that I love so much. If you really have a lot of stuff to store, you can place several models next to each other you and create a street of closets or a room-divider.
